Bernard Rosenblatt is a scholar working on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, Psychiatry and Mental health and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Bernard Rosenblatt has authored 76 papers receiving a total of 3.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, 18 papers in Psychiatry and Mental health and 15 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Bernard Rosenblatt’s work include Neonatal and fetal brain pathology (21 papers), Congenital Heart Disease Studies (14 papers) and Infant Development and Preterm Care (13 papers). Bernard Rosenblatt is often cited by papers focused on Neonatal and fetal brain pathology (21 papers), Congenital Heart Disease Studies (14 papers) and Infant Development and Preterm Care (13 papers). Bernard Rosenblatt collaborates with scholars based in Canada, United States and Australia. Bernard Rosenblatt's co-authors include Annette Majnemer, Michael Shevell, Christo I. Tchervenkov, Charles Rohlicek and Catherine Limperopoulos and has published in prestigious journals such as Neurology, PEDIATRICS and Annals of Neurology.
